Subject: [PATCH 1/3] config/riscv: detect V extension

The RISC-V C api defines architecture extension test macros
These let us detect whether the V extension is supported on the
compiler and -march we're building with. The C api also defines V
intrinsics we can use rather than inline assembly on newer versions of
GCC (14.1.0+) and Clang (18.1.0+).

If the V extension and intrinsics are both present and we can detect
the V extension at runtime, we define a flag, RTE_RISCV_FEATURE_V.

diff --git a/config/riscv/meson.build b/config/riscv/meson.build
index 7562c6cb99..e3694cf2e6 100644
--- a/config/riscv/meson.build
+++ b/config/riscv/meson.build
@@ -119,6 +119,31 @@ foreach flag: arch_config['machine_args']
     endif
 endforeach
 
+# check if we can do buildtime detection of extensions supported by the target
+riscv_extension_macros = false
+if (cc.get_define('__riscv_arch_test', args: machine_args) == '1')
+  message('Detected architecture extension test macros')
+  riscv_extension_macros = true
+else
+  warning('RISC-V architecture extension test macros not available. Build-time detection of extensions not possible')
+endif
+
+# detect extensions
+# Requires intrinsics available in GCC 14.1.0+ and Clang 18.1.0+
+if (riscv_extension_macros and
+    (cc.get_define('__riscv_vector', args: machine_args) != ''))
+  if ((cc.get_id() == 'gcc' and cc.version().version_compare('>=14.1.0'))
+      or (cc.get_id() == 'clang' and cc.version().version_compare('>=18.1.0')))
+    if (cc.compiles('''#include <riscv_vector.h>
+        int main(void) { size_t vl = __riscv_vsetvl_e32m1(1); }''', args: machine_args))
+      message('Compiling with the V extension')
+      machine_args += ['-DRTE_RISCV_FEATURE_V']
+    endif
+  else
+    warning('Detected V extension but cannot use because intrinsics are not available (present in GCC 14.1.0+ and Clang 18.1.0+)')
+  endif
+endif
+
